Biography

Playfully mixing and deconstructing various genres to create its own sonic world, the seminal band hasn’t stopped changing shape and form throughout its existence (the only permanent member being its initiator, Crammed Discs boss Marc Hollander). Aksak Maboul now revolves around Hollander & Véronique Vincent. After a long gap, they’ve written & recorded a brand-new double LP, 'Figures' (out in 2020). Hollander founded Aksak Maboul in 1977 with Vincent Kenis. Each of the band’s albums is stylistically different from the others, yet they all share common aesthetic and musical foundations. Released in 1977 and 1980, the band’s first two albums ('Onze danses pour combattre la migraine'and 'Un peu de l’âme des bandits') are avant-garde classics, a status reconfirmed by the reactions to their recent vinyl reissues. After these inaugural releases, Hollander devoted himself to his Crammed Discs label, and resumed his activities as a musician in 2014, with the release of 'Ex-Futur Album', the 3rd, ‘lost’ Aksak Maboul album, written & recorded with Véronique Vincent thirty years earlier. A new incarnation of the band then took back to the stage, and recorded the acclaimed ‘Figures’. Aksak Maboul's fifth album is entitled 'Une Aventure de VV (Songspiel)'. Described as an ‘experimental audio play’, it came out in March 2023, as part of the Made To Measure series.
